September 30, 200916 yr I'm sure I asked this before, but I cant find the post...Every time I have to readback to VOXATC, I have to say twice the instruction... I hold my PPT key, I hear the click, wait one second, then readback the instruction or clearance. Release the PPT key, yet the green text remains and if I wait long enough VOXATC will ask me if I received my instructions... I have to say twice everything to ATC... October 2, 200916 yr Hello?Anyone?cricket cricketHey... I did pay for the software... Wheres the support?Hi ssanchezI had the same problem. In my case it was that my headset mike had been disabled and my voice was then being picked up by my bad webcam mike. I had to repeat every time. Check if its your mike thats not set up correctly!!!
